Contractors in Fleet, Hampshire,
Contractors
Unit 6, Great Bramshot Farm Barns, Bramshot Lane,
Fleet, Hampshire ,
GU51 2SF
UNITED KINGDOM
Worldwide > United Kingdom > Fleet, Hampshire > Contractors